A veterinary tech can be trained to work in a variety of environments, and so the job description could change slightly depending on where you work. Working in a research lab would mean you'd be responsible for feeding and taking care of the animals, as well as charting their behavior.
Veterinary Tech Job Description
If you work in a vet clinic though, you will still feed and care for the animals, but you will also help the vet treat the animals. This could mean holding the animals when they are being checked, giving injections, taking xrays, performing dentistry, spaying or neutering and euthanasia.
You will also have daily tasks like getting and maintaining the animal's histories, collecting samples and analysing them in the lab, ordering and stocking drugs and preparing the instruments needed for surgery. You could even work in emergency care or at a zoo, with completely different requirements. Your veterinarian tech training should prepare you for all these duties.
Necessary Training
In order to become a vet tech, you need to train at veterinarian schools to get the required education. Generally, veterinarian tech training consists of getting an associate's degree in 16-24 months, but there are also 4 year bachelor's degree programs that often lead students to go on to complete their master's degree.
Having these advanced degrees will significantly increase the cap of your salary. Your veterinary technician school should be accredited by the American Veterinary Medical Association (AVMA), and there are even 10 distance courses that are accredited to take.
You should also look for a school that offers an extensive internship or externship to gain practical experience. After your studies, you will need to become certified, and although the certification exam varies in some states, most use the National Veterinary Technician (NVT) for technicians looking to work in a clinic.
If you want to work in a research lab, you should get your American Association for Laboratory Animal Science (AALAS). There are many certification exams available, so make sure you pass the one required by your state and that will offer you the opportunities you want.
Salaries
A vet tech is not the highest paid worker there is, but you have to look at the complete package to decide if it is worth your while. Often vet techs are offered a complete benefit package that makes up for the lower income.
Also, if you decide to work in a research lab, you will start out with a lower salary than in a private clinic, but the research position's salary will increase at a faster rate.
Your level of education is also a huge factor, as are your experience and if you decide to work in a big practice in the city, or a small country clinic.
In general, the average vet tech salary is about $29,000 a year, with the top 10% earning as high as $40,000 a year.
